NIPOST stands for Nigerian Postal Service, which is responsible for the delivery of mail and other postal services in Nigeria. Therefore, the function of NIPOST is to provide postal services such as sending and receiving letters, parcels, and documents both domestically and internationally. One of the specific functions of NIPOST is issuing money orders, which allows for the transfer of money from one location to another.
